Breaking Developments Across Industries
AI is no longer limited to technology companies alone. It is now reshaping multiple industries worldwide. In healthcare, AI-powered systems are helping doctors diagnose diseases faster and more accurately. Machine learning tools can analyze medical records, detect patterns, and support personalized treatment plans. Hospitals are increasingly using robotic assistance and automated monitoring systems to improve patient care.
The finance industry is also experiencing major transformation. Banks and financial institutions are using AI to detect fraud, automate customer support, and improve investment strategies. Smart algorithms can analyze large amounts of financial data in real time, helping organizations make better decisions and reduce operational risks.
Manufacturing and logistics companies are benefiting from AI-driven automation as well. Smart factories equipped with robotics and predictive maintenance systems are increasing productivity while reducing downtime. Self-driving technologies and intelligent supply chain management systems are further revolutionizing transportation and delivery services.

Governments and AI Regulations
As AI technology grows more powerful, governments worldwide are introducing regulations to manage its development responsibly. Policymakers are concerned about issues such as misinformation, deepfakes, algorithmic bias, and data privacy. New laws are being designed to ensure transparency and accountability in AI systems while protecting public interests.
Several countries are collaborating on international AI standards to promote ethical technology use. Governments are encouraging companies to adopt responsible AI practices and improve cybersecurity protections. These initiatives aim to balance innovation with safety, ensuring that AI benefits society without creating unnecessary risks.

Global Tech Growth Trends in 2026
Cloud computing remains one of the most important drivers of global tech growth. Businesses are increasingly moving their operations to cloud-based systems because they offer flexibility, scalability, and improved data management. AI integration within cloud platforms allows organizations to process information more efficiently and automate complex workflows.
Another rapidly expanding sector is semiconductor manufacturing. AI systems require powerful chips capable of processing massive amounts of data quickly. As demand for AI-powered devices grows, semiconductor companies are investing heavily in advanced chip production technologies. This has led to increased competition among global manufacturers and new investments in research facilities.
Cybersecurity is another major focus area. With digital transformation accelerating worldwide, cyber threats are becoming more sophisticated. Companies are adopting AI-driven cybersecurity tools to identify vulnerabilities, monitor suspicious activities, and prevent data breaches. These intelligent systems help organizations strengthen digital defenses while responding faster to emerging threats.

Economic Impact of AI
AI is expected to contribute trillions of dollars to the global economy over the next decade. Businesses using automation and machine learning technologies can improve productivity, reduce operational costs, and enhance decision-making processes. Digital transformation is also creating new business models and remote work opportunities across industries.
However, AI growth also presents challenges. Concerns about job displacement, ethical decision-making, and misinformation remain important topics of discussion. Experts believe that while some traditional jobs may disappear, new technology-related careers will emerge in areas such as AI engineering, cybersecurity, robotics, and data analysis.
Energy consumption is another growing concern. Large AI systems require significant computing power, increasing demand for data centers and electricity. Technology companies are now investing in sustainable infrastructure and renewable energy solutions to reduce environmental impact while supporting future growth.
